    Paul, there are a number of steel mills in the East Chicago-Gary, IN, area along the lakefront. I can recall USSteel, Bethlehem, and Inland from my days with the Chicago & Indiana. Can't remember over whose line the Chicago-Detroit trains operated. Of course, USX owns USSteel and used to own the EJ&E. I do not recall seeing any cow and calf units, though.
